Exegesis

Temporal markers ba’erev {בָּעֶ֛רֶב | bā-ʿe-rev} ‘in the evening’, bayom {בַּיּוֹם | ba-yom} ‘on the day’, and la-boker {לַבֹּקֶר׃ | la-bo-ker} ‘to the morning’ define the prohibited interval. The parallel syntax reinforces the absolute nature of the festival purity laws.

In contextDeuteronomy 16:4

And no leaven shall be seen in all your territory for seven days; nor shall any of the meat which you sacrifice on the evening of the first day remain until the morning.
